linux技术文章
-
- GitLab在Linux性能调优的实用技巧
- 在Linux环境下对GitLab进行性能优化是确保其高效运行的关键步骤。以下是几种重要的优化手段:硬件与系统优化选用高性能硬件:为GitLab配备高规格的硬件设施,比如强大的处理器、充足的内存以及高速的存储设备。优先选用SSD而非HDD,从而加快数据传输速率。确保稳定的运行环境:维持一个稳定可靠的服务器工作环境,预防网络延迟及硬件故障的发生。定期执行数据备份:建立自动化的备份机制,并周期性地检查恢复程序的有效性,以防数据遗失。GitLab自身配置优化调节并发请求量:依据当前的工作负载和硬件能力,适当调整G
- 文章 · linux | 1年前 | 319浏览 收藏
-
- Linux挂载网络共享详解:mount命令使用教程
- 在Linux系统中,利用mount命令挂载网络共享通常需要遵循几个步骤。以下是详细的指导说明:1.明确网络共享的种类首先,你需要了解网络共享的具体类型。常见的类型包括:NFS(网络文件系统)SMB/CIFS(服务器消息块/通用互联网文件系统)FTP(文件传输协议)SSHFS(安全壳层文件系统)2.安装必要的软件包根据共享类型的不同,你可能需要安装相应的软件包。NFSsudoapt-getinstallnfs-common#Debian/Ubuntusudoyuminstall
- 文章 · linux | 1年前 | 133浏览 收藏
-
- SFTP在Linux中的使用详解与操作教程
- SFTP在Linux中的使用教程SFTP(安全文件传输协议)是一种基于SSH的安全文件传输协议,用于在客户端与服务器之间传输文件。它提供数据加密和身份验证功能,确保文件传输的安全性。安装SFTP服务器在大多数Linux发行版中,OpenSSH软件包默认已安装,其中包含了SFTP服务。如果需要安装或确认是否已安装,可以使用以下命令:#对于基于Debian的系统(如Ubuntu)sudoapt-getinstallopenssh-server对于基于RPM的系统(如CentOS、Fedora)su
- 文章 · linux | 1年前 | 443浏览 收藏
-
- Linux系统清理误区与正确方法揭秘
- 在Linux系统中进行清理时,存在一些常见的误区。以下是一些需要注意的方面:1.误删重要文件原因:对文件系统结构不熟悉,或者使用错误的命令删除了关键文件。建议:在执行删除操作前,务必确认文件路径和内容。2.过度清理系统缓存原因:认为清理缓存可以释放大量磁盘空间,但实际上缓存是系统性能优化的关键部分。建议:适度清理缓存,例如使用sync;echo3>/proc/sys/v
- 文章 · linux | 1年前 | 393浏览 收藏
-
- Linuxreaddir加速目录遍历的黑科技
- 在Linux环境下,readdir函数常用于读取目录内的文件与子目录信息。为了加快通过readdir进行目录遍历的速度,可采取以下策略:降低系统调用次数:避免频繁调用readdir,尽量一次性获取多个目录项。比如,可以结合opendir与readdir来完成目录遍历,而非针对每个子目录单独调用opendir。启用缓存机制:在遍历期间,把已访问过的目录详情保存至缓存里,之后若需查询这些信息,则直接从缓存提取,而非重新发起readdir请求。此举能有效减少磁盘输入输出操作,从而加快遍历进程。采用多线程或多进程
- 文章 · linux | 1年前 | 422浏览 收藏
-
- Debian下PHP连接MySQL数据库教程
- 在Debian操作系统中使用PHP与MySQL数据库交互,你需要安装PHP的MySQL支持库,并运用PHP内置的数据库操作函数。以下是实现这一功能的基本流程:安装PHP和MySQL:若尚未安装PHP和MySQL,首先需完成其安装。可借助apt工具来完成相关软件包的安装:sudoaptupdatesudoaptinstallphpphp-mysqlmysql-server安装期间,系统可能要求配置MySQL的安全设置,如设定root账户密码等。重启MySQL服务:完成安装后,重启My
- 文章 · linux | 1年前 | 424浏览 收藏
-
- GitLabLinux版安全性评测及防护建议
- GitLab在Linux环境下的安全性是一个多维度的话题,需要从不同方面进行全面考量。以下是关于GitLab在Linux中安全性的一个深度剖析:GitLab在Linux中的安全性基础安全设置:这包括设置防火墙、采用HTTPS协议、实施访问权限管理、配置SSH认证、定期执行数据备份、保持GitLab的版本更新、检查并分析日志以及启用双因素认证等。进阶安全手段:比如加强密码规则、管控文件上传、对敏感文档进行加密、开展安全审计、实施实时监控及日志追踪等。针对Linux环境的特别注意点:在Linux平台上部署和调
- 文章 · linux | 1年前 | 273浏览 收藏
-
- Linux改主机名方法及配置文件位置
- 在Linux系统中修改主机名需区分临时与永久修改并注意配置文件位置。1.查看当前主机名可使用hostname或hostnamectl命令。2.临时修改使用sudohostnamenew-hostname命令重启后失效。3.永久修改需编辑/etc/hostname文件替换旧名为新名,并同步更新/etc/hosts中的127.0.1.1条目以确保本地解析正常。4.配置文件主要位于/etc/hostname和/etc/hosts,systemd系统也可用hostnamectlset-hostname命令自动更新
- 文章 · linux | 1年前 | 326浏览 收藏
-
- LinuxOracle视图创建与维护实用技巧
- 在Linux系统中构建和管理Oracle视图,您可以按照以下流程进行操作:构建视图连接至Oracle数据库:通过SQL*Plus或其他数据库管理工具接入Oracle数据库。构建CREATEVIEW语句:视图是基于SQL查询结果生成的虚拟表。利用CREATEVIEW语句来设定视图。例如:CREATEVIEWstaff_viewASSELECTstaff_id,first_name,last_name,section_idFROMstaffs;此处,staff_view即为视图,它展
- 文章 · linux | 1年前 | 178浏览 收藏
-
- Linuxreaddir文件名编码处理秘诀
- 在Linux中,readdir函数用于读取目录中的文件和子目录。当处理文件名编码时,需要注意以下几点:传统的Linux系统使用ASCII编码,但现代Linux系统通常使用UTF-8编码。因此,在处理文件名时,建议使用UTF-8编码。readdir函数返回的文件名是以null字符(‘\0’)结尾的C风格字符串。在处理这些字符串时,需要确保正确处理null字符。在处理包含非ASCII字
- 文章 · linux | 1年前 | 356浏览 收藏
-
- LinuxpgAdmin定时任务设置详解
- pgAdmin是一个用于管理PostgreSQL数据库的图形用户界面工具,但它本身并不提供设置定时任务的功能。定时任务通常是通过操作系统的Cron守护进程来管理的。在Linux系统中,你可以通过crontab命令来设置和管理定时任务。以下是如何在Linux系统中设置定时任务的基本步骤:设置定时任务的基本步骤登录到Linux系统查看定时任务列表:使用命令crontab-l查看当前用户的所有定时任务。创建定时任务:使用命令crontab-e编辑当前用户的定时任务。编辑完成
- 文章 · linux | 1年前 | 229浏览 收藏
-
- Linux文件完整性检查:md5sum与sha256sum使用攻略
- 在Linux中检查文件完整性可通过md5sum和sha256sum实现。1.md5sum可用于生成MD5校验和,命令为“md5sumfilename”,也可通过“md5sum-cchecksums.md5”验证文件一致性;2.sha256sum更安全,推荐使用,命令为“sha256sumfilename”,批量验证可用“sha256sum-cchecksums.sha256”;3.使用时需注意路径正确、大小写敏感、文本编码影响,并可结合脚本自动化处理。
- 文章 · linux | 1年前 | 102浏览 收藏
-
- Linux系统copendir优化使用技巧
- 在Linux系统中,copyleft是一种版权许可方式,它要求任何发布或修改过的软件,如果再次发布,必须以相同的许可方式发布。这与copyright(版权)不同,后者通常禁止他人修改和分发软件。然而,你提到的copendir并不是一个标准的Linux命令或函数。可能你是想问如何优化opendir和readdir的使用,这两个函数通常用于在C语言中遍历目录。以下是一些优化opend
- 文章 · linux | 1年前 | 293浏览 收藏
-
- Linux中Hadoop网络配置深度解析
- 在Linux中配置Hadoop网络涉及多个步骤,包括设置静态IP地址、配置主机名、修改hosts文件、配置SSH免密码登录以及配置Hadoop的核心配置文件。以下是详细的配置步骤:1.设置静态IP地址在所有节点上配置静态IP地址。例如,使用/etc/network/interfaces文件(Debian/Ubuntu)或/etc/sysconfig/network-scripts/ifcfg
- 文章 · linux | 1年前 | 157浏览 收藏
-
- DebianMySQL连接问题解决秘籍
- 在Debian系统上解决MySQL连接问题可以按照以下步骤进行排查和解决:检查MySQL服务状态:首先,确保MySQL服务正在运行。可以使用以下命令检查MySQL服务的状态:sudosystemctlstatusmysql如果服务未运行,可以使用以下命令启动它:sudosystemctlstartmysql或者设置MySQL服务开机自启动:sudosystemct
- 文章 · linux | 1年前 | 303浏览 收藏
查看更多
课程推荐
-
- 前端进阶之JavaScript设计模式
- 设计模式是开发人员在软件开发过程中面临一般问题时的解决方案,代表了最佳的实践。本课程的主打内容包括JS常见设计模式以及具体应用场景,打造一站式知识长龙服务,适合有JS基础的同学学习。
- 543次学习
-
- GO语言核心编程课程
- 本课程采用真实案例,全面具体可落地,从理论到实践,一步一步将GO核心编程技术、编程思想、底层实现融会贯通,使学习者贴近时代脉搏,做IT互联网时代的弄潮儿。
- 516次学习
-
- 简单聊聊mysql8与网络通信
- 如有问题加微信:Le-studyg;在课程中,我们将首先介绍MySQL8的新特性,包括性能优化、安全增强、新数据类型等,帮助学生快速熟悉MySQL8的最新功能。接着,我们将深入解析MySQL的网络通信机制,包括协议、连接管理、数据传输等,让
- 500次学习
-
- JavaScript正则表达式基础与实战
- 在任何一门编程语言中,正则表达式,都是一项重要的知识,它提供了高效的字符串匹配与捕获机制,可以极大的简化程序设计。
- 487次学习
-
- 从零制作响应式网站—Grid布局
- 本系列教程将展示从零制作一个假想的网络科技公司官网,分为导航,轮播,关于我们,成功案例,服务流程,团队介绍,数据部分,公司动态,底部信息等内容区块。网站整体采用CSSGrid布局,支持响应式,有流畅过渡和展现动画。
- 485次学习
-
- Golang深入理解GPM模型
- Golang深入理解GPM调度器模型及全场景分析,希望您看完这套视频有所收获;包括调度器的由来和分析、GMP模型简介、以及11个场景总结。
- 474次学习
查看更多
AI推荐
-
- 剧云
- 剧云是专业中文剧本创作平台,安全稳定运行十余年,集成AI编剧、剧本医生审核、人物小传、剧情关系图、大纲编写、多人协作、Word导入导出、版权管控功能,数据安全防护,轻松高效创作剧本。
- 20次使用
-
- 万象有声
- 万象有声,一个专为有声创作者打造的新一代智能有声内容创作平台。平台提供专业的智能拆章、智能画本编辑、AI配音、AI生成音效、后期制作、智能对轨、智能审听等有声创作全流程工具,可以帮助创作者高效、低成本创作出引人入胜的有声作品。立即体验,让有声书制作更简单!
- 28次使用
-
- Red Skill
- 小红书创作服务平台为小红书创作者和机构提供视频上传、数据分析、粉丝管理、创作指导等多项运营服务,助力用户解锁更多创作者专属功能,体验高效创作!
- 33次使用
-
- MiMo Code
- MiMo Code 是小米大模型团队开源的新一代 AI 编程助手,面向开发者提供代码理解、生成与辅助开发能力,适合作为 AI 编程工具收藏和体验。
- 126次使用
-
- TRAE Work
- TRAE AI IDE | 国内首款 AI 原生集成开发环境,深度集成 Doubao-1.5-pro 与 DeepSeek 模型,支持中文自然语言一键生成完整代码框架,实时预览前端效果并智能修复 BUG。首创 Builder 模式实现需求到代码的自动化开发,兼容 Windows/macOS 系统,官网下载即用。
- 152次使用

